  •    What are the rules for the specifications of a table tennis bat during a tournament ?
  •    I see players giving the bat over to the umpires . What is exactly is checked before the game.
  •    Also in case there are scratches in the rubber does it disqualify the player.

They are checking to make sure the rubber is approved.  They also check that the rubber isn't damaged in any way.  It needs to be an even surface.  So if there are any chips or scratches out of it they will usually not allow you to use it.

Are there any specific rules on the weight or thickness of the paddle?


Alois Rosario

Alois Rosario from PingSkills Posted 10 years ago

Hi Arnab,

The wood can be any thickness and weight.  It is only the rubber that is regulated.
